如何在php

时间:2016-04-10 13:23:37

标签: php mysql arrays

我正在尝试将字母转换为数组。

所有字母都来自mysql结果

    for($column=0;$column<8;$column++){
        echo '<div class="'.bluexyz.'">'.
        $field1 = mysql_fetch_object($sql)->code
.'</div>';
}

每个字母都是一个名为bluexyz的div。

现在我想把这些字母转换成数组。

我在forloop里面使用了爆炸,但是没有工作。

$array = explode('\n',$field1); 

它将所有字母放在[0]的数组索引中。我想在一个索引中放一个字母。

1 个答案:

答案 0 :(得分:1)

如果您提供更清晰的解释并提供您正在获取的内容以及您期望输出的具体内容,则会更容易。

根据我的理解,您正在尝试将$ field1字符串转换为数组。

您可以在此处使用str_split() function

试试这个:

$array = str_split($field1);
echo "<pre>";
print_r($array);
echo "</pre>";

希望这有帮助。